Output 71dadc648ece00aa2ca0d9587dc4e1ea209602ed34f203e14250ba8a16ecc8bd:1

value
143349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5de94c1f6c823c9c636c38088f5edd45beaaeb45 OP_EQUAL
address
3AFaFAiaeasvhco4ebTUbHTS3H6oZNYyMG
transaction
71dadc648ece00aa2ca0d9587dc4e1ea209602ed34f203e14250ba8a16ecc8bd
confirmations
350753
spent
true